Hello everyone, my name is Ethan, but you probably don't know me. I, back in July, made a case that I am still half-proud of. The account's name was Kadakruss. When I went to log on to the account a fee months ago, it wouldn't let me because "Maximum login attempts allowed. As well as your username and password, you must now pass the CAPTCHA test" or something along those lines. Except, there was no test that showed up. I went to reset my password and it gave me a 404. I contacted the admins a few months back to no response. I've tried logging in from multiple devices. Does anyone know if I can fix this or if my old account is gone forever? And I've taken the suggestion of using Firefox. No luck. I've also tried Chrome and Microsoft Edge. Nothing. I've even installed the new version of Java. Nope. Any help appreciated.

Glad to hear that. In future, for account recovery problems, you're best off contacting the site admin, Unas. His email address is on the front page, and he's the only person who can help with this sort of thing.
